e-Residency application, step by step

A walkthrough of the e-Residency application as administered by the Ministry of the Interior.

This page describes the e-Residency application as it currently runs at eres.gov.campfira.org.

Before you start

You will need:

  • An email address you can receive mail at.
  • A government-issued photo identity document (passport, driver's licence, or national identity card).
  • A device with a camera, for the selfie and the short identity-verification video.
  • A means of payment for the €25 application fee. Visa, Mastercard, or American Express, via Stripe.

The eight steps

The application is divided into eight steps. The form auto-saves after each step.

  1. Personal details. Legal name, date of birth, and place of birth.
  2. Current residence. Your current postal address and residence status.
  3. Citizenships held. Any citizenships you currently hold elsewhere.
  4. Background disclosures. A short criminal-history declaration.
  5. Identity documents. Upload of your government-issued ID, a live selfie, and a short identity-verification video.
  6. Review. A read-only summary of your answers.
  7. Payment. Stripe Checkout for the €25 fee.
  8. Confirmation. Your confirmation ID and a link to track your application status.

After you submit

Most decisions are recorded within fourteen days. You are notified at the email address you registered with. On approval, the system issues a Citizen Identity Number and a temporary password. Sign in at my.gov.campfira.org with these credentials.

If your application is rejected, the rejection notice includes the reason. You may resubmit a new application after a 24-hour cooling-off period.

Data handling

All identity documents and verification material are encrypted at rest with industry-standard authenticated encryption. Decryption keys are held by a dedicated key-management system isolated from the application services and never released to them in plaintext form.
